This is an authentic imported console, typically sourced from regions like Japan, Hong Kong, Canada, or Mexico. Since region locking depends on your Nintendo account, not the console, all systems work seamlessly in the US. You can set English as your default language just like a domestic model. While the console itself is region-free, the Mario Kart World Tour game voucher is region-locked. According to a user review, here’s a workaround to redeem the download voucher with a US Nintendo account:
"The item arrived quickly and as described. Note that since these units come from Hong Kong, you’ll need to temporarily switch your Nintendo account region to Hong Kong to activate the Mario Kart code. Once redeemed, the game works normally, and you can change your region back."

AliExpress is an international online marketplace, and as with any platform, not every seller is guaranteed to be legitimate. Lucky Tech Store, the seller here, has been active since October 2024 and offers PlayStation and Nintendo Switch consoles among other electronics. Another Nintendo Switch listing from the same seller includes reviews confirming receipt of a legitimate, though imported, console. While we expect the same here, we haven’t personally ordered from this seller. AliExpress provides several buyer protections, including a small discount for delayed delivery and a full refund if the item is lost, damaged, or not delivered within 20 days of ordering.Can You Trust This AliExpress Listing?
